Kenneth L. Fisher
Author, Forbes Columnist, CEO Fisher Investments

Ken Fisher is an investment manager, author, and financial thinker of this generation. Ken has proven himself in the investment marketplace with numerous, accurate market calls that often are the exact opposite of most Wall Street speculations. His experience in the markets has also enabled him to create several different Fisher Investments strategies for client investment portfolios. Fisher Investments strategies are unique to the firm, and are the results of closely studying market trends and fluctuations.

Ken is the founder, Chairman and CEO of Fisher Investments, a multi-billion dollar, multi-product money management firm providing most major product categories and serving the institutional and high net worth investors in the U.S., the UK, and Canada. As a leading independent investment management firm, Fisher Investments participates in global equity and fixed income markets. The firm’s affiliate, Grüner Fisher Investments GmbH,* also services investors in Germany.

Ken has written four high-profile financial books to date: best-selling Super Stocks, The Wall Street Waltz, 100 Minds that Made the Market, and his most recent, New York Times Best Seller The Only Three Questions That Count.

Ken is most well known for his monthly Forbes Portfolio Strategy column, which he's been writing for 24 years. In addition, Ken Fisher has been published, interviewed and/or been written about in numerous major American, British, and German finance and business periodicals. He writes a weekly column for Handelsblatt, Germany's leading daily.

Often published in professional and scholarly journals, including prize-winning works, for two decades his research has spawned many new concepts that are now often adopted into today's core financial curriculum. His recent research focuses on the emerging field called behavioral finance, where behavioral psychology and finance intersect.

Ken's hobbies include the history of Kings Mountain, California and 19th century redwood lumbering history. He resides in Woodside, California with his wife, Sherrilyn.
